Yogi Adityanath and Akhilesh Yadav are not leaving any chance to attack each other. It has become the case that whenever Yogi Adityanath makes any statement, Akhilesh Yadav also reacts with similar sharpness – and the trend continues.

While the debate between the abbots and the mafia was going on in Gorakhpur,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ath, while referring to some viral videos on social media, took aim at Samajwadi Party leader Akhilesh Yadav – and it didn’t take long for Akhilesh Yadav to take to social media to react as well.

In fact, 10 assembly seats in Uttar Pradesh will go to by-elections – all these fights are being fought for this goal. The seats where by-elections are also held include Ayodhya Mirkipur seat and Mainpuri Kajal seat. Akhilesh Yadav’s effort is to retain the two Samajwadi Party seats at all costs, while Yogi Adityanath is trying to wrest the two seats from Akhilesh Yadav at all costs to be able to settle the BJP’s defeat in Ayodhya.

“Toroutis and Habur Juice”

Yogi Adityanath comes to inaugurate a ‘floating restaurant’ at Ramgarh Tal in Gorakhpur Obviously, whenever one talks about restaurants, food and drinks come up and when there is an election atmosphere, the discussion takes on a political tone.

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ath said: “At least Hapur juice or tainted roti will not be served to the people, which is a good thing… Everything served here is pure.”

Although it was about food and drink, it was just an excuse. In reality, Yogi Adityanath was promoting himself and cleverly incorporated viral videos on social media into it.

Some time ago, a video from a restaurant in Saharanpur went viral in which a boy was seen spitting on roti while it was being made. Similarly, videos of spitting and sometimes urine mixed in juice also went viral. When all the cases came to light, the police took action and the accused were arrested.

When a video like this goes viral, there is a lot of uproar and a political angle is found in it. What happens politically is that people from a particular community are accused of being involved in a criminal act that has been exposed through the video.

As Akhilesh Yadav is engaging in Yadav politics and Muslim votes in UP, Yogi Adityanath is targeting the Samajwadi Party through such videos which are going viral on social media.

Akhilesh Yadav on the question of yogi’s “language”

The uproar caused by Akhilesh Yadav’s remarks has not yet died down, and the former chief minister of UP has rolled a new dice on the social networking site X.

Now he is talking about identifying saints through language. Akhilsh Yadav, who had already raised the ire of saints by saying that there is no difference between abbots and mafias, has now stirred up a new controversy by questioning their language.

Yogi Adityanath started making clarifications when he took the statement of mafia don and leader Akhilesh Yadav saying that the spirit of Aurangzeb has entered the SP leaders.

Akhilesh Yadav clarified that neither he nor the Samajwadi Party had made any comment on any saint, mahant or monk. He said, I will only say that he is the chief minister of our state…what language can we expect from him…since the BJP’s defeat, his language has changed.

Now, Akhilesh Yadav wrote in his social media post, “Recognize the real saint mahant through language… There is unlimited cunning in the world roaming in the name of saints.”
